大概说一下原理:创建100个光源(点),如果鼠标在画布上,让它们的初始位置在鼠标的位置(利用addEventListener(“mousemove”),大小为初始大小。透明度为1,然后随着时间的改变,大小逐渐变小,透明度逐渐降低(用setInterval()方法实现),当半径或者透明度中某一项为0时,光源已经不可见了,便将它重置为初始时的样子。效果你可以点击下面的按钮进入演示页。至于代码,如果你是开发人员,你应该知道键盘上有个F12。可在下方留言问我要加注释的源代码。